Senior Network Engineer
Egg Harbor, NJ - USA
Job Summary
OCH Technologies is seeking a highly skilled Senior Network Engineer to join our team supporting the FAA. This role involves complex network infrastructure systems across multiple sites.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ience with enterprise-level systems strong expertise in Cisco and VMware technologies and a proven ability to troubleshoot complex interconnected environments. This role also requires excellent documentation skills as well as experience managing system upgrades and evaluating new technologies and solutions.
This position supports a proposal effort and is contingent upon award customer approval and successful onboarding requirements.
Location:
Hybrid- FAA William J. Hughes Technical Center - Egg Harbor NJ
Core Responsibilities & Duties
- Design implement and maintain highly available secure and scalable network architectures.
- Oversee operations and performance of environments ensuring uptime redundancy and resilience.
- Implement network modernization optimization and continuous improvement initiatives.
- Manage and support core networking technologies including routing switching load balancing and network security.
- Provide Tier 2 troubleshooting and root cause analysis for complex network issues.
- Oversee and optimize performance using monitoring and diagnostic tools.
- Collaborate with infrastructure security and application teams to ensure seamless system integration.
- Create and maintain network documentation standards and SOPs.
- Support federal compliance standards and frameworks (e.g. NIST FAA guidelines where applicable).
- Participate in strategic planning capacity planning and technology road mapping.
- Participate in on-call rotation for critical issues.
- Support configuration management and IT logistics activities.
- Assist with systems testing and maintenance.
- Occasional travel to government facilities is required.
- Monitor and analyze network logs alerts and telemetry to proactively identify and address potential failures before they impact operations.
- Perform security maintenance tasks on network infrastructure including vulnerability remediation compliance patching and verification of security hardening standards.
The responsibilities and duties listed above are flexible and subject to change based on operational need.
Minimum Qualifications
Education:
Bachelors degree in engineering Science or Math
Experience:
- A minimum of eight (8) years of relevant experience in network engineering including design implementation
- Experience with Cisco networking technologies (routing switching firewalls)
- Hands on experience implementing high availability and failover solutions (HSRP VRRP redundant paths load balancing)
- Experience with network disaster recovery planning and execution
- Experience managing multi-site enterprise network environments
- Experience supporting both Windows and Linux environments
- Experience with VMware virtualization platforms
- Experience with network monitoring and analysis tools (e.g. SolarWinds Wireshark ManageEngine or equivalent)
- Strong understanding of network security principles and best practices
- Experience creating technical documentation and system diagrams
Security Clearance Requirement:
Candidate must have the ability to hold and maintain a Secret Clearance
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ience with Cisco technologies including ASA ISR and Catalyst platforms
- Experience with data center network operations
- Familiarity with Jira Confluence and Bitbucket
- Experience with closed network systems and data streaming protocols
- Experience with wide area network engineering and radar data distribution environments
- Proficient in Linux environments primarily RHEL and CentOS
- Experience with automation and scripting (Python Ansible etc.)
- FAA NAS experience
- Experience with cloud networking (AWS Azure) and hybrid cloud environments
- Familiarity with CIS security guidelines and configuration compliance
- Relevant certifications such as CCNA CCNP or other networking or security certifications
